Choosing Your Energy Wingman: Battery Types Decoded
Picking a battery is like dating – chemistry matters! Here’s the 411 on today’s top contenders:
Type | Lifespan | Cost/kWh | Best For |
---|---|---|---|
Lithium-ion | 10-15 years | $800-$1,200 | Daily cycling |
Saltwater | 15+ years | $1,000-$1,500 | Eco-warriors |
Lead-acid | 5-8 years | $400-$800 | Budget backup |
Pro Tip:
Look for batteries with ”stackable” capacity – it’s like LEGO for energy storage. Start with 10kWh now, add modules later as needs grow.
Installation Ins and Outs: No Hard Hat Required
Retrofitting batteries to existing solar isn’t rocket science, but there’s some wizardry involved. Key considerations:
- Inverter compatibility (Hybrid vs. AC-coupled systems)
- Panel derating for older solar arrays
- Smart load management integration
A San Diego brewery nailed their installation by time-shifting refrigeration loads. Their industrial chillers now run on stored solar energy, keeping beers cold without grid guilt.

Real Talk About ROI
While upfront costs sting ($10k-$20k), batteries pay off faster than you think. Massachusetts offers $1,000/kWh rebates – combine that with federal credits, and you’re looking at 5-7 year payback periods. Cha-ching!
